In Revelation 11:15 the persistent prayer of the church is answered. “The kingdom of the world has become the kingdom of our Lord and of his Christ, and he shall reign forever and ever.”
In this answered prayer we are reminded that God delights to answer our prayer. Even the most remarkable request. The vision of the Seventh Trumpet declares that we are not forgotten by our God. Our prayers are not in vain. Therefore, we ought to pray boldly, earnestly, and expectantly. Not vainly or carelessly.
